The board of health of the borough has heretofore by an ordinance
adopted May 7, 1962 incorporated by reference into the ordinance of
the board of health of the borough the "Swimming Pool Code of the
State of New Jersey (1955)" and the board of health of the borough
and the mayor and council deem it advisable that the ordinance be
supplemented by an ordinance regulating the location, construction,
alteration, and operation of public swimming pools and the establishing
of license fees and permit fees in connection therewith.
The definitions set forth in Section 1 of the "Swimming Pool
Code of the State of New Jersey (1955)," heretofore adopted under
an ordinance of the board of health of the borough which section sets
forth certain definitions, is hereby incorporated by reference.
No persons shall locate and construct, alter or operate a swimming
pool until a license therefore shall have been issued by the board
of health of the borough.
The following fees and charges are herewith established:
a. For the issuance of a license to locate and construct a swimming
pool - $50.
b. For the issuance of a license to alter a swimming pool - $50.
c. For the issuance or removal of a license to operate a swimming pool
- $150.
Licenses issued for the operation of a swimming pool shall expire
annually on December 31 of each year, and each of the licenses shall
be for one calendar year. Application for renewal of a license shall
be submitted together with the required fee, prior to December 15
of the year prior to the calendar year during which the license is
to be effective.
Licenses required by this chapter may be denied or suspended
by the board of health of the borough for failure on the part of the
license-holder to comply with the "Swimming Pool Code of the State
of New Jersey (1955)" which code was adopted by reference by the board
of health of the borough by an ordinance of May 7, 1962, or for failure
to comply with the sanitary code of the borough.
The board of health shall afford the person whose license to
locate and construct, alter and operate has been denied or suspended,
an opportunity to be heard in the public hearing.
